How the mowing robot works? Key features of the ride-on mower

The mowing robot is a small, cordless, battery-powered device that moves efficiently around the lawn thanks to a built-in navigation system. Most robots need a so-called boundary wire for this purpose, which marks the boundaries of the mowing area. Some models are also GPS-assisted or controlled manually, with the help of a remote control.

Due to its small size, robotic mowers do not collect the cut grass, but mulch it - shred the cut blades and leave them on the surface of the lawn. This has 2 significant advantages: after mowing the lawn, there is no need to rake it, and the grass residue decomposes, becoming a natural, ecological and completely free fertilizer.

How to choose the best mowing robot for the size and shape of your garden?

Mowing robots are a large and very diverse group of equipment with different functions and purposes. For this reason, it is impossible to point to a single device that works for every garden - a good electric ride-on mower should be tailored to both the specifics of your lawn and your expectations.

When buying a robotic mower, it is worth analyzing:

  • lawn area - The larger the garden, the longer the operating time of the mower on a single charge should be. Owners of large gardens can also appreciate the built-in GPS navigation system, large mowing width
  • relief - for an even and flat lawn, you only need a basic robot, without advanced driving systems, special wheels and hill climbing features
  • the degree of complexity of the garden - alleys, flowerbeds, pots set on the grass and planted plants are quite a hindrance to the self-propelled mower. If your mowing robot will have to avoid a lot of obstacles, deal with uneven lawn edges or cross paved paths, consider buying a device with an obstacle memory system, sensors that detect obstacles or with GPS navigation.
robot koszący do 500 m2 kosi trawę w ogrodzie; w tle kobieta odpoczywająca na leżaku

If you determine the needs of your garden, look at the parameters of the robot:

  • navigation - GPS, installation with a demarcation wire, or perhaps no installation at all?
  • battery capacity and charging time to full
  • type of wheels - Their number, size, the material from which they are made and the type and height of the tread
  • mowing width - The bigger it is, the faster the robot will cut the lawn
  • height of cut adjustment - every good mowing robot should have it. The optimal adjustment range is 3-6 cm
  • maximum slope - for a level lawn, 25% is enough, while for a hilly garden with large differences in height, it is better to bet on 50-70%
  • security - PIN code lock prevents children from starting the robot, but also discourages thieves - without knowing the PIN, the robot will be useless.

Which mowing robot for a 200 m garden2?

For mowing a lawn with a small area, you can choose one of the simpler, and at the same time cheaper, models of ride-on mowers. Battery capacity, charging time and mowing width will not be crucial. A 20×10 m lawn also does not "require" a device with GPS, Wi-Fi or features that elevate the price of the robot.

What a mowing robot should have for a 200m garden2?

  • navigation with the help of a restraining cable - With simple lawns in regular shapes, you may even be tempted to buy a robotic mower without a restraining wire
  • compact size (of the robot itself and the charging station) - in a small garden, every inch of space is important, so it is not worth cluttering it with a sizable garage
  • control by buttons on the housing - The exception will be users who value convenience: for them, a robot controlled with a remote control or mobile application will work better
  • as low a volume as possible - in a small garden, the rest area and the lawn are usually located right next to each other. In order not to disturb household members, the mowing robot should be quiet, that is, generate less than 60 dB of noise.

Which mowing robot for a 500 m garden2?

A robotic mower for a medium-sized garden doesn't have to be top-of-the-line technology or price point equipment. If you are a technomaniac, you like gadgets and technological innovations, then we won't stop you from buying a self-propelled lawn mower with GPS, Bluetooth function, smart control and a lot of options available on the mobile app. In our opinion, however, for a garden of 500 m2 a robot equipped with:

  • capacious battery, that will allow a minimum of 60 minutes of continuous mowing. If you don't want mowing to last all day, aim for robots that can run 90 or even 120 minutes on 1 charge
  • mowing capacity greater than the area of the lawn - the mowing performance quoted in the specification usually refers to ideal conditions that are almost impossible to reproduce in a real garden. So it is worth leaving the robot some "spare" and choosing a model with a slightly larger mowing area, such as for a lawn of 500 m2 we recommend robots with a capacity of 600m2
  • navigation with the help of a demarcation wire - Is effective and at the same time does not significantly increase the price of the robot. Of course, to the garden 500 m2 you can also choose a mower with GPS navigation, which is effective and convenient, but more expensive
  • average mowing width, which will amount to approx. 18 cm. For medium-sized gardens, mowing width is not a key parameter - it is definitely not worth paying extra for 1 or 2 extra centimeters
  • anti-collision sensors - will allow to efficiently avoid obstacles in the form of plants, edges, children's playground, etc.
  • additional features if you want the robot to mow in your absence - In this case, a Wi-Fi module that allows remote control of the mower from a mobile app and a rain sensor that detects adverse weather conditions and stops mowing will work well.

Which mowing robot for a garden of 1000 m2?

As the size of the garden increases, the number of self-propelled mower models that can handle such a large lawn decreases. The price of equipment is also increasing, so with a limited budget you sometimes have to compromise by choosing a more advanced device from a niche brand or a simpler mower, but signed with a recognizable logo. Whichever option you choose, make sure your new mowing robot for a large garden will have:

  • durable battery - A good mowing robot for a large garden should run on 1 charge for at least 90 minutes
  • short charging time to full - mowing a lawn of 1000 m2 will require a break to recharge the battery. If you want the robot to tackle its task as quickly as possible, look for equipment that will charge in 1.5-2 hours at most
  • zone mowing function - Will make mowing easier in gardens where the lawn is located in several places, np. in front of and behind the house
  • anti-collision sensors - prevent the robot from colliding with obstacles and objects left on the lawn
  • gPS navigation or with the help of a delimiting cable - With a garden of this size, it is worth considering the purchase of a mowing robot with GPS. This type of navigation will allow you to create a map of your garden, and combined with a mobile app, it will enable you to, for example, mow only a selected part of the lawn and designate zones with different mowing heights
  • mowing width of more than 18 cm - if you care about the speed of mowing, choose a robot with a long blade and a cutting width oscillating around 20 cm
  • edge mowing function - Reduces the need to use a trimmer on the edge of the lawn, thus saving you time.

Which mowing robot to buy for a large 2000 m garden2?

If your lawn has as much as 2,000 m2, then you definitely need help mowing it! Self-propelled mowers for such large areas are the most advanced equipment that are not afraid of any challenge. Parameters of mowing robots up to 3000 m2 and 5000 m2 will be similar - the main difference between these devices is in their performance.

Good ride-on mower for 2000 m garden2 and bigger should have"

  • the longest possible operating time on 1 charge - here I don't think anything needs to be explained. A very large garden needs to be mowed for a very long time, so you should choose robots equipped with a capacious battery. Advanced equipment can run for up to 2 hours or more on 1 charge!
  • gPS navigation - the most effective and easiest to install, given the size of the garden
  • zone mowing function, which allows you to mow several lawns located within the same garden. If your budget allows it, consider buying a mower with the ability to set different mowing heights in different parts of the garden and with a mapping function that allows you to "send" the mower to a specific place
  • largest cutting width - 20 cm is the absolute minimum. Recommended mowing robots for large gardens usually have mowing widths exceeding 22 or even 24 cm
  • anti-collision sensors - detect obstacles and make it easier for the robot to move around the garden. An interesting solution is ultrasonic sensors, which locate the obstacle and then brake the robot before it bumps into it
  • rain sensor - Advanced robots for large areas usually have them as standard.
  • edge mowing function - Minimizes the amount of touch-ups and the need to use a trimmer at the edge of the lawn. In large, complex gardens, it can translate into considerable time savings.

What kind of mowing robot for rough terrain?

Just as important as the lawn area already discussed is the terrain in your garden. A lawn as even as a pool table can be handled by almost any robotic mower. The stairs begin when the garden is full of bumps, hills and overhangs, overgrown clumps of grass, stones, molehills and any other obstacles that the self-propelled mower has to deal with. If you have an uneven lawn, look out for robotic mowers equipped with:

  • automatic knife lift function before invading an obstacle, such as an overgrown clump of grass, a stone or the edge of a garden path
  • large wheels with high tread, which will easily overcome even sizable obstacles and will not lose traction on sloping terrain
  • 4-wheel drive - Prevents the mower from hanging on obstacles when one of the driven wheels loses contact with the ground. If the terrain is very uneven, consider buying a robot with the function of controlling each wheel separately
  • ability to work at a significant slope (up to 70%) - match it to the conditions in your garden. If the maximum slope of your lawn is 30%, there is no point in overpaying for a mower that works at a 70% slope.
